    Don't you think there is a reason why the protection circuit prevents charging? Not only are you bypassing the chargers electronic, you are also practically short-circuiting the healthy battery because there is no current limit. You can only hope that there is still a protective circuit in the battery itself or that the internal resistance of the dead battery is high enough. Ok, most lithium batteries don't start to burn or explode, but increased self-discharge, lower capacity and reduced ampere output do not increase the joy of working. If you accept the risk with a deeply discharged battery, use a laboratory power supply. The problem with your method is, that not all cells are discharged and you do not ensure, that the charge levels are balanced. The “effect” therefore is only for a short time.
